H.H. Sheikh Hamdan highlights Dubai’s role in shaping future of tourism

Dubai Media Office

Dubai will continue to play a key role in shaping the future of global travel and tourism, guided by innovation, strong partnerships and an ambitious vision.

That's the message from His Highness Sheikh Hamdan bin Mohammed bin Rashid Al Maktoum, Dubai's Crown Prince and the UAE's Deputy Prime Minister and Defence Minister.

He made the remarks during a visit to the 33rd edition of Arabian Travel Market at Dubai World Trade Centre.

Running until September 17, the event brings together travel and tourism leaders, companies and organisations from the UAE and around the world.

Sheikh Hamdan said Dubai’s hosting of Arabian Travel Market reinforces its position as a leading global destination and highlights its ability to bring together industry leaders to explore new opportunities for growth.

He added that the event provides an important platform for cooperation, knowledge exchange and new partnerships that can support the future of the tourism sector.

During his tour, Sheikh Hamdan visited several pavilions, where he reviewed new products, services and initiatives aimed at enhancing the traveller experience.

The event is focusing on major trends reshaping global tourism, including artificial intelligence, digital transformation, changing traveller expectations and sustainable growth.
